<p>The art of face painting can be a relative low-cost venture.  Amateurs and professionals alike can enjoy face painting either for profit or simply to entertain their own children.  Should you decide to give it a try, there are books available for beginners for as low as $13.  If you prefer a hands-on approach to learning, a safe bet would be to begin with a kit.  Adventurous moms can find face painting supplies as close as their make-up pouches.</p>
<p>Most supplies for face painting include water based paints for easy removal.  The problem sometimes with the face paint is the quality of the product.  Hot weather can be an enemy as the perspiration can ruin the artwork or cause the person being painted to perspire while you are trying to apply the paint.</p>
<p>Serious painters will find the need to invest in the proper, good quality brushes.  Detail brushes are sold as low as $3 each.  A brush can make a big difference in the finished quality of your work.  If you purchase a cheap brush with an end that is too big or frays or scatters easily, you could be sorely disappointed in the outcome and having to fight the brush to get the effect you desire.</p>
<p>Theme sets are a popular choice for face painting.  Used especially at Halloween, these are sold with instructions to achieve whole face outcomes.  A person can enjoy becoming like a lion, monster, pirate, mermaid, ghost, cat, mouse, favorite cartoon character, and much more.  Parent will want to be sure their child is of the right maturity level to sit still long enough for the paint to be applied start to finish.</p>

<p>If you don&#8217;t want the full face effect, don&#8217;t worry.  Smaller designs can be added to enhance the effect of your costume.  Some stores sell rubber stamps in their supplies for face painting.  The stamps are created with a deeper impression and simple designs to make fill-in work quick and easy.  They have foam backing for easier use.  The cost is about $8 USD each and the size is 2 inches by 2 inches.</p>
<p>Some face painting kits are sold for as little as $4 a kit.  These would be fine for children to use for play or for beginning artists to use just for practice or fun.  They provide a low-cost option for charity events, such as school fundraisers or church functions where the overhead must be kept low.  Some kits are sold with 6 face paint pencils, a sharpener, sponge, and white face paint for a base color.</p>
<p>For the more advanced artists, stencils are sold at prices ranging from $35 to $85; including a video.  These are used with airbrushing, which has become a more popular form of face painting.  Glitter gels and stick-on jewelry can be added to accent your artwork.</p>
<p>When choosing face painting supplies, you may want to include paper, pencil, and markers to give yourself a starting point for ideas.  You also could buy a piece of poster board or cardstock to show your available choices for purchase when setting up your booth.  Maybe you&#8217;ll want to invest in a carry-all, chair, and small folding table as well.</p>

<p>There are many types of paints to use in  face paintings, but not all of them are safe. The only types paints you want to use in your  face paintings are skin safe paints. It does not matter if it says natural, non-toxic, chemical free, or any other reference to being chemical safe. Chemical safe does not mean that the paint was designed or tested for skin use. </p>
<p>If you use any types of glitter, then you need to use only FDA approved glitter for cosmetic purposes. This type of glitter fits the safety and types of substances that are safe to use for the face. </p>

<p>When you clean your brushes and any other equipment that you use for your  face paintings, only use water to clean them. If you use chemical agents, then there could still be residue left from the chemical that can pose a safety hazard when using it the next time. </p>
<p>One very important tip when doing  face paintings is to not paint on anyone who has sensitive skin, has abrasions or injuries to the face, or who even has acne problems that can turn into open wounds. These types of skin situations can lead to some serious repercussions. To be safe, it is better to not take a risk and avoid doing  face paintings in these types of situations. </p>
<p>The most important aspect of face painting is to protect yourself. Always make sure that you have your body in a comfortable position at all times. Many people do not realize that you can seriously sustain an injury from doing  face paintings. This can happen due to continually keeping your body in different positions, as well as bending your body, arms, wrists and hands back and forth. Always be sure to make sure that your body is not becoming to tense and be sure to to some small stretching breaks to relieve your bodies tension. </p>

<p>The cheetah is the fastest land animal.  It can gain speeds up to 70 miles per hour, but it uses up energy fast.  It&#8217;s one of the smaller cats, weighing an average of 145 pounds.  The cheetah has long legs to aid in its graceful agility.  It is of the lion family, similar to a jaguar in appearance.  Whereas the tiger has stripes, the cheetah has spots.  There are what is called &#8216;tear drops&#8217;, which are black lines of color running alongside its nose on either side from inside the top of the eye down to the tip of the top lip.  There is plain yellowish coloring along the nose, white whiskers, and a white chin.  There are spots on the forehead, cheeks, and over the eye area.</p>

<p>Simple face painting designs can be very simple things that can use as little as one or two colors. You can get a persons face and make a  simple face painting design by coloring half of that persons face one color and the other half another color. You could even make it so that the design goes vertical, horizontal or diagonal. There are many face painters who do simple designs such as American flags, simply by using this two part technique, then add details to the two different base colors that are split on the face.  Some face painters do simple things as painting a simple star, sun, moon, and other simple on shape designs that people love. Kids especially love simple face painting designs that can be done very easily with little effort at all. There are an endless number of  simple face painting designs that use common shapes.</p>

<p>Another clown who reached fame long ago was called Bozo the Clown.  Bozo&#8217;s face had a large white base, covering even his neck area.  There was a big red, bulbous nose, exaggerated red mouth, and tall black eyebrows.  He complimented his painted face with crazy red hair.  He was possibly the most famous of clowns.  There was even a Mexican version of Bozo.<br />
Each clown must perfect his or her own face painting to convey their personality.  There are sad clowns, happy clowns, perpetually surprised clowns.  They invest in their look, carefully choosing supplies and additions to their painted faces that will last throughout their act and must spend hours practicing to make each act its best.<br />
For those who entertain the notion of becoming a clown, there are books available to guide you on your journey to find the clown face and style that is right for you.  The eyes alone can speak volumes, so choose your design carefully.  A second revealing feature is that of the mouth area.  The face is meant to enhance the overall image you want to portray.  It should compliment your own features.</p>
<p>The supplies for a clown face involve concealer, foundations, highlights, shadows, neutralizers, brushes, glitter, mineral powders, sealers, adhesives, cleaners, applicators, sponges, and skin treatments.  Invest in good quality supplies for a long-lasting satisfaction with the products.</p>
